Mt Ruapehu, NZ inline for massive changes
Sat 18 March 06
Over the next 2 years $25million is due to be spent upgrading the lift system and installing huge snowmaking facilities at both Whakapapa and Turoa
Mt Ruapehu, NZ inline for massive changes ©
Proposed changes
$30m in new development over the next two years. This will include the installation of three high speed chairlifts and a major snowmaking system over the next two years.
Whakapapa will see the installation of the Tennants Express four seater over the summer of 2006/2007 and the Valley Express six seater in the 2007/2008 summer.
Turoa will see a massive upgrade to its current snowmaking capacity with a new 50 million litre reservoir and 25 new snow guns. This will take snowmaking to the top of the Movenpick Chairlift. Perhaps more exciting is the installation of the 1.4km High Noon Express six seater chairlift. This lift runs from the top of the Movenpick to the top of the High Noon T-bar. We’re confident that both these projects will be completed for the 2007 winter.
Rasing the cash
RAL aims to raise $25 million from a Life Pass issue to help fund the new development. 7000 people will get the opportunity to buy a life pass to the resorts, so you'll never have to pay a cent again, obviously at $3875 they ain't cheap, and if you want to be able to transfer it to someone $4995 you can buy a Life Plus Pass .
